Olivia Andrus-Drennan is the producer, director, cinematographer, editor, and owner of Big Sky Genesis Productions LLC. She graduated from Montana State University with the Science and Natural History Filmmaking Degree in the fall of 2022. She has produced many different award-winning documentaries such as The Dolphin Dilemma, Diversified: The Florida Panther Story, Grounded, and Beauty. She has worked closely with many different departments within Montana
State University on different promotional videos for the College of Letters & Science, Math department, lab-based videos for the College of Letters & Sciences Chemistry department, and development and research for the film Aging in Style 2 for the College of Nursing. Her company created three political and instructional videos for Montana VOICES about how to create a public comment in the state of Montana. She has worked on many scientific documentaries for companies such as The Marine Mammal Center, Marine Mammal Foundation, Don Edwards San Francisco Bay Wildlife Refuge, Guadalupe River Park Conservancy, the Indiana Department of Natural Resources, and the American Chemical Society.
